BSES, one of Delhi's two electricity distribution companies (discoms), on Monday announced the opening of its first Digi Seva Kendra to provide single window computerised facilities for customers to apply for various services.

"These state-of-the-art centres, modelled on the Passport Seva Kendras, will offer quick and convenient single window services to customers, who can apply for a host of services like new connection, load/name/category change, among others," a BSES release said here.A

"Leveraging technology, including Aadhar card based authentication, the end-to-end use of digitised paperless process will help in substantially reducing the turnaround time by around 200 per cent (from 8 days to under 4 for in case of a new connection)," it said.

BSES' first Digi Seva Kendra here opened at Nehru Place, and more centres are to be opened across the discom's license area in the capital, it added.

This will cater do around 2 lakh customers in the discom's Nehru Place and Alaknanda Divisions," the statement said.

"It was inaugurated by Delhi MLAs Madan Lal, Saurabh Bhardwaj, Avtar Singh and Sahi Ram Pahelwan," it added.
